Ransomware – 3 Ways to Protect Yourself
You’ve seen the news about Ransomware attacks. The latest battle is won but the war is not over. And Magento users be aware there is an attack that targets your store.
Upgrade to Windows 10 and Turn On Windows Update
If you are running an older version of Windows upgrade right now. Then be sure Windows Update is turned on (it is by default). The easiest way to do that is to click on the Cortana icon (the circle next to the Windows start icon) and type “Windows Update”. Click the Advanced Settings link and in the settings that open make sure updates are not deferred (set to 0) and Pause is Off.
Turn off SMBv1
In Windows 10 click the Cortana icon and type “Turn Windows features on or off”. In the dialog that opens uncheck the box for SMB 1.0/CIFS File Sharing Support. Close the dialog and when prompted restart your PC. Note: You can turn off this protocol in Windows 7 and 8 as well by opening Control Panel and clicking Programs then the Windows on/off option, but you are still otherwise unprotected until you upgrade to Windows 10.
Magento Users
New ransomware called KimcilWare is currently targeting websites running the Magento e-commerce platform. Make sure you are running a current version and keep an eye on all security updates at https://magento.com/security/patches/magento-204-security-update
